Transaction 34c25909087da4d9e465fa990c0400ab7616a0899131eaa8e4fefc0246df9961
1 Input
1 Output
-
34c25909087da4d9e465fa990c0400ab7616a0899131eaa8e4fefc0246df9961:0
- value
- 459281
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a829f5f17d4b05d6f1f93f03969d814e47de6dcf OP_EQUAL
- address
- 3H2BiFd7JDsDJzhk1WYmPcPZV6kMh3uhTQ